How you'll contribute A Clinical Documentation Specialist RN who
excels in this role: - Reviews inpatient medical records to
identify missing, vague, or incomplete documentation and ensures
timely resolution of provider queries. - Ensures medical records
accurately reflect clinical treatment, decisions, and diagnoses,
supporting hospital quality reporting and outcomes. - Uses clinical
and coding expertise to query physicians for specificity of
procedures and diagnoses, following hospital policy and accepted
coding guidelines. - Tracks and trends documentation opportunities
using metrics to support process improvement initiatives. -
Provides guidance and education to physicians and clinical staff on
best practices for clinical documentation and regulatory
compliance. - Collaborates with interdisciplinary teams to support
quality initiatives, improve workflow, and enhance patient care
outcomes. Schedule: Full-Time, Days Why join us We believe that

and career advancement opportunities. What we're looking for -
Valid West Virginia RN license required. - BCLS certification
required. - Associate's degree in Nursing required. - Bachelor's
degree in Nursing preferred. - RHIA, RHIT, CCDS, or CDIP
certification preferred. - Minimum of 2-3 years of clinical
documentation improvement experience preferred. - Strong knowledge
of ICD-10 coding guidelines, clinical documentation standards, and
hospital regulatory requirements, including CMS and Joint
Commission standards. - Excellent communication and collaboration
skills, with the ability to work effectively with physicians, case
managers, coders, and other healthcare staff. - Critical thinking,
problem-solving, and organizational skills, with the ability to
manage multiple tasks in a fast-paced hospital environment. More
